Abstract

A system based on the model of overdamped fractional Langevin equation is constructed, the relation between fractional order and stochastic resonance is studied, it is found that stochastic resonance phenomenon is not produced or not obvious with given certain weak periodic signal and noise intensity. Applying external periodic signal is proposed to produce or strengthen stochastic resonance. The numerical simulations show that the stochastic resonance phenomenon can be effectively controlled, by changing the external periodic signal’s frequency or amplitude. We find the non-monotonic behaviors between the driving parameters and signal-to-noise(SNR). Optimal stochastic resonance can be achieved by adjusting one of the parameters as frequency and amplitude.
